Market Dynamics and Pricing Strategies
The RTX 5090's pricing strategy reflects a confluence of supply chain complexities, demand-supply imbalance. And strategic market positioning. The semiconductor shortage. Which has plagued the industry for years, has driven up costs and constrained supply, directly impacting the RTX 5090's price. Moreover, the RTX 5090 targets a niche market of high-end gamers and professional users who are willing to pay a premium for the latest technology. This pricing strategy not only recoups the significant R&D investment but also signals the value of innovation in the tech market.
